DHT-3, which stands for Diesel Hydrotreater, is primarily utilized in diesel service. This process is essential for the production of cleaner-burning diesel fuel by removing impurities such as sulfur, nitrogen, and aromatics from crude oil fractions. The diesel hydrotreater operation typically involves hydrogenation, where hydrogen is added to the diesel feedstock in the presence of catalysts. This not only helps in producing a higher quality diesel that meets stringent environmental regulations but also improves the overall performance characteristics of the fuel.

The focus of DHT-3 on diesel service is vital in the context of refining, as the demand for low-sulfur diesel fuel has increased significantly due to regulatory standards aimed at reducing vehicle emissions. This enhancement of diesel fuel quality allows refineries to comply with environmental guidelines effectively while meeting consumer needs.
